# iOS H5 下载文件
在 iOS 的 H5 开发中,我们常常需要实现文件的下载功能,例如下载图片、音频、视频或者其他文件。本文将介绍如何在 iOS 的 H5 页面中实现文件下载,并给出相关的代码示例。
## 实现思路
要在 iOS 的 H5 页面中实现文件下载功能,我们可以借助 HTML5 提供的 `` 标签和 JavaScript 来完成。具体实现步骤如下:
1. 在 H5 页面中
原创
2023-12-01 13:50:07
982阅读
## H5 iOS 下载文件
### 简介
在移动应用开发中,经常会遇到需要在 iOS 设备上下载文件的需求。HTML5 提供了一种方便的方式,通过使用 `` 标签的 `download` 属性,可以实现在浏览器中下载文件。本文将介绍如何在 H5 iOS 环境中实现文件下载,并给出代码示例。
### 文件下载流程
在介绍具体的实现方法之前,我们先来了解一下文件下载的基本流程。
1. 用户
原创
2023-10-16 07:05:41
215阅读
# H5 在 iOS 上下载文件的实现
在现代网页开发中,HTML5(H5)提供了众多强大的功能,其中之一就是文件下载功能。对于 iOS 设备,我们需要一些额外的考虑,因为 Safari 浏览器的行为略有不同。本文将为你详细介绍如何在 H5 页面上实现文件下载,特别是在 iOS 设备上下载文件的方法。
## 一、文件下载流程
在 H5 中下载文件的基本流程包含以下几个步骤:
1. 用户触发
原创
2024-09-21 07:43:39
292阅读
以ASP.NET Core WebAPI 作后端 API ,用 Vue 构建前端页面,用 Axios 从前端访问后端 API ,包括文件的上传和下载。准备文件上传的API#region 文件上传 可以带参数
[HttpPost("upload")]
public JsonResult
转载
2024-01-27 11:38:27
237阅读
文章目录前言一、技术介绍二、项目源码2.1 前端代码(HTML5)2.2 后端源码(C#)2.3 前端代码(JavaScript)三、效果展示3.1 运行 WebAPI项目3.2 运行安卓手机四、资源链接 前言本专栏为 前端【H5】专栏,主要介绍HTML知识点。对于刚进入计算机世界的学生来说,学习课本上的知识是远远不够的,并且国内教材偏旧,所以需要我们通过互联网自主学习。 这里普及一个知识:HT
转载
2024-08-16 07:46:33
160阅读
前段时间有个项目需要在H5页面里下载文档文件,由于项目需求这里采用Android系统自带DownloadManager来进行后台自动下载管理,我们只需要稍微设置几个参数就进行文件下载了,并且下载进行时和下载完成后会有通知显示,话不多说直接上代码:由于是WebView中的操作,这里需要监听WebView的下载监听,每当WebView中有下载操作都会回调这个方法,代码如下:web.setDownloa
转载
2024-05-16 09:38:44
245阅读
# 如何在H5页面中实现iOS系统下载文件
## 操作流程
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 用户点击下载按钮 |
| 2 | 调用JavaScript函数执行下载操作 |
| 3 | 浏览器弹出选择下载方式的提示 |
| 4 | 用户选择使用Safari浏览器下载 |
```mermaid
journey
title 该流程包含以下步骤
s
原创
2024-03-28 07:42:30
78阅读
# 如何在 iOS App 中通过 H5 下载文件
在现代应用开发中,将 H5(HTML5)与原生应用结合是一个常见的需求。在 iOS App 中实现用户通过 H5 下载文件的功能并不复杂。下面我将为你阐明整个流程,并提供必要的代码示例。
## 整体流程
首先,我们来看一下实现“iOS App H5 下载文件”的整体流程:
| 步骤 | 描述 |
原创
2024-09-17 05:34:25
237阅读
H5 iOS 下载文件 URL 的技术挑战及解决方案
在现代 web 开发中,H5 技术的普及使得用户在用于 iOS 设备时,不可避免地面临文件下载的问题。在许多情况下,用户需要通过 URL 下载一系列文件,这在 iOS 系统中常常会出现兼容性和实现效率的问题。以下是我对如何解决“H5 iOS 下载文件 URL”问题的系统记录,涵盖版本对比、迁移指南、兼容性处理、实战案例、性能优化及生态扩展等方
# 如何在H5中实现iOS文件下载
在iOS设备上实现文件下载,可以是一项冗长而复杂的任务,尤其是对于初学者。本文将逐步引导你完成这一过程,包括各个步骤、所需要的代码以及其用途。如有疑问,欢迎随时交流。
## 整体流程
首先,让我们看一下整个实现流程。下表简要概括了所需的步骤:
| 步骤 | 描述 |
|------|--
原创
2024-10-30 03:44:02
103阅读
# 在React H5应用中实现iOS文件下载
在现代的Web开发中,文件下载功能是一个常见的需求。尤其是在移动设备上,比如iOS系统的设备,如何实现从React H5应用中下载文件是许多开发者关注的重点。本文将为大家介绍如何在React H5应用中实现这一功能,并通过示例代码进行详细阐述。
## 下载文件的基本原理
在Web应用中,文件下载通常通过创建一个指向目标文件的链接来实现。当用户点
# IOS H5 下载文件功能
在移动端的web应用中,有时候需要给用户提供下载文件的功能,比如下载PDF文档、图片、音频、视频等。本文将介绍如何在IOS的H5应用中实现下载文件的功能,并提供相应的代码示例。
## 实现步骤
要实现在IOS的H5应用中下载文件的功能,可以通过以下步骤进行:
1. 在页面中添加一个下载按钮,用户点击按钮时触发文件下载功能。
2. 通过Javascript代码
原创
2024-05-07 07:35:53
230阅读
首先放一个今天学到的小demo:<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>测试</title>
<style>
* {
margin: 0;
转载
2024-10-08 18:24:32
39阅读
一、HTML与文件下载如果希望在前端侧直接触发某些资源的下载,最方便快捷的方法就是使用HTML5原生的download属性,例如:<a href="large.jpg" download>下载</a>但显然,如果纯粹利用HTML属性来实现文件的下载(而不是浏览器打开或浏览),对于动态内容,就无能为力。例如,我们对页面进行分享的时候,希望分享图片是页面内容的实时截图,此时,这
前端下载页面a 标签下载使用 a 标签下载原理,利用 h5 a 标签 download 属性,点击页面 a 标签后即可下载<a href='url' download="filename.ext">下载</a>js利用a标签下载注意,添加 link.target = '_blank' 和 document.body.append(link)
转载
2023-07-12 13:55:29
2864阅读
一、download属性是个什么鬼?首先看下面这种截图:如果我们想实现点击上面的下载按钮下载一张图片,你会如何实现?我们可能会想到一个最简单的方法,就是直接按钮a标签链接一张图片,类似下面这样:<ahref="large.jpg">下载</a>但是,想法虽好,实际效果却不是我们想要的,因为浏览器可以直接浏览图片,因此,我们点击下面的“下载”链接,并是不下载图片,而是在新窗口
转载
2024-05-21 16:12:38
118阅读
1. a 标签通过a标签的download属性来实现文件下载,这种方式是最简单的,也是我们比较常用的方式,示例代码:<a href="http://www.baidu.com" download="baidu.html">下载</a>就上面的这个示例,我们点击下载,发现是跳转到了百度的首页,并没有真的下载文件。因为a标签下载只能下载同源的文件,如果是跨域的文件,这里包括图片
转载
2023-11-12 14:47:12
239阅读
前端对于文件下载这块的一些常用的基本方法。 **一 通过a标签来下载文件** 在html5中 a 标签多了一个属性download;没有添加download属性,用户点击a链接浏览器会打开并显示该链接的内容,若在a链接中加了 download 属性,点击该链接就不会打开这个文件,而是直接下载。注意:download属性是html5中的a标签的新特性,与不支持h5的低版本浏览器不兼容!ex: <
转载
2024-06-05 07:28:41
71阅读
H5将网页数据导出为Excel并可下载在制作webapp中,遇到个要将数据导出为Excel的问题。我搜索了一下网上的方案,可以直接将HTML的表格导出为Excel文件,这些方法在电脑上确实是可行的,当时如果放到手机上导出的Excel根本不能下载,手机下载文件都是已网络链接的形式,直接导出的文件在手机上是获取不到的。我搜遍网上的资料都没有发现有讲在手机上将网页数据导出Excel的,于是只能自己去摸索
转载
2023-10-16 09:57:27
314阅读
配套视频:https://www.bilibili.com/video/BV1oA411B7gv/
背景今天鼓捣了一下手机投屏到笔记本,就想录个视频展示一下学习成果,正好就想起了很早之前实现的这个功能。 H5文件下载是一个很简单的功能,但是把这个H5放在安卓版微信打开,功能就不能用了,因为安卓端的微信内置浏览器拦截了所有下载文件的请求。 即使微信的sdk也没有提供直接保存文件的接口,所以出路只有一
转载
2023-09-04 09:08:53
1515阅读